    Juve boss Allegri: 'Zaza stays'

    During the press conference that foresees the TIM Cup game against Lazio, Juventus head coach Massimiliano Allegri has also talked about the transfer market: “The forwards that will play tomorrow will be suitable for such important game. Zaza won’t leave, he will stay with us”.
     
    “Mandragora is a young player who is doing very well” he added “our club’s policy regarding the young talents is very important for the future. Grosso’s youth team is doing very well, Lirola is a good player, as well as others”
     
    Regarding the situation of Paul Pogba, who didn’t start for the game against Udinese, the Tuscan tactician explained: “Pogba has always played, staying out for a game is not a problem. Morata must do more, he has great qualities, but he shouldn’t be obsessed about scoring goals”
